§  450.70 Appeal  by  defendant directly to court of appeals; in what cases authorized. An appeal directly to the court of appeals may be taken as of right by  the defendant from the following  judgment  and  orders  of  a  superior  court: 1.  A judgment including a sentence of death; 2. An  order  denying a motion, made pursuant to section 440.10, to  vacate a judgment including a sentence of death; 3. An order denying a motion, made pursuant to section 440.20, to  set  aside a sentence of death; 4.  An  order  denying  a  motion,  made  pursuant to paragraph (d) of  subdivision eleven of section 400.27, to set aside a sentence of death.
